inspired
Prononciation : [ɪnˈspaɪərd]
Mot
Contexte : « emotion/creativity »
(adjective) feeling very excited and enthusiastic because of something you saw, heard, or thought about. When you are inspired, you want to do something creative or special.
Exemple
She felt inspired by the beautiful painting and decided to create her own art.
Exemple
He didn't feel inspired at all and couldn't think of any good ideas.
Exemple
What inspired you to start writing stories?
Contexte : « creativity/influence »
(verb) to make someone feel excited to do something or to give them a new idea. When you inspire someone, you encourage them to be creative or to take action.
Exemple
The teacher inspired her students to love science through fun experiments.
Exemple
The boring movie did not inspire anyone in the audience.
Exemple
Who inspires you the most in your life?
